Raising awareness of air pollution
A new agreement concerning monitoring pollutant levels has been signed

France is to measure 90 air polluting substances and pesticides from 2018 onwards, in a bid to raise the public’s awareness of the quality of the air.
A new agreement to monitor levels of pollutants, pesticides and fine particles in the air has been signed between air quality surveillance organisation Atmo France and food and environment safety agency Anses.
